Buscar

Linguagem SQL: Conceitos Básicos

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 5 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

 Pergunta 1 
0,25 em 0,25 pontos 
 
São tipos de linguagem SQL: 
Resposta Selecionada: c. 
DDL e DML. 
Respostas: a. 
OCR. 
 b. 
ITIL. 
 c. 
DDL e DML. 
 d. 
PMI. 
 e. 
CRM.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: C 
Comentário: os tipos de linguagem SQL são DDL, DML, 
DCL, DTL e DQL. 
 
 
 Pergunta 2 
0,25 em 0,25 pontos 
 
É através da linguagem SQL que é feita a iteração entre analistas / 
especialistas / DBAs com o banco de dados. Entre todas as 
possibilidades, o que não é possível fazer com a linguagem SQL? 
 
Resposta Selecionada: a. 
Formatar o banco de dados. 
Respostas: a. 
Formatar o banco de dados. 
 b. 
Criar tabelas. 
 c. 
Dar acesso a usuários. 
 d. 
Excluir um banco de dados. 
 e. 
Consultar dados em uma tabela.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: A 
Comentário: um banco pode até ser excluído, mas não 
pode ser formatado. 
 
 
 Pergunta 3 
0,25 em 0,25 pontos 
 
Um especialista SQL trabalha com um determinado banco A. Tempos 
depois, ele é contratado por outra empresa para trabalhar com um 
banco B, totalmente diferente do anterior. A adaptação do especialista 
ao novo banco será pequena porque: 
 
Resposta 
Selecionada: 
a. 
A linguagem SQL é padronizada pela ANSI, sendo usada 
a mesma linguagem para todos os bancos com poucas 
diferenças entre si. 
Respostas: a. 
A linguagem SQL é padronizada pela ANSI, sendo usada 
a mesma linguagem para todos os bancos com poucas 
diferenças entre si. 
 b. 
O banco B é uma evolução do banco A. 
 c. 
Os dois bancos pertencem ao mesmo fabricante. 
 d. 
Todas as alternativas anteriores estão corretas. 
 e. 
NDA.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: A 
Comentário: por ser padronizada, a linguagem SQL é a 
mesma para todos os bancos de dados relacionais, com 
poucas diferenças entre um banco e outro. 
 
 
 Pergunta 4 
0,25 em 0,25 pontos 
 
Quando falamos de INSERT, DELETE e UPDATE, estamos falando de 
que tipo de linguagem SQL? 
 
Resposta Selecionada: c. 
DML. 
Respostas: a. 
DCL. 
 b. 
DQL. 
 c. 
DML. 
 d. 
DTL. 
 e. 
DDL.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: C 
Comentário: DML, ou Data Manipulation Language, é a 
linguagem que manipula os dados através dos comandos 
INSERT, DELETE e UPDATE. 
DCL é a linguagem de controle, DQL é a de consulta, DTL 
é a de transação e a DDL, de definição. 
 
 
 Pergunta 5 
0,25 em 0,25 pontos 
 
Quando estamos acessando informações de mais de uma tabela, 
temos que usar JOINS ou junções entre as tabelas através de um 
atributo em comum. São tipos de JOINS, exceto: 
 
Resposta Selecionada: c. 
ULTRA JOIN. 
Respostas: a. 
INNER JOIN. 
 b. 
LEFT OUTER JOIN. 
 c. 
ULTRA JOIN. 
 d. 
RIGHT OUTER JOIN. 
 e. 
CROSS JOIN.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: C 
Comentário: todos são tipos permitidos de JOINS entre 
as tabelas, exceto o ULTRA JOIN que não existe. 
 
 
 Pergunta 6 
0,25 em 0,25 pontos 
 
O banco de dados possui diversos objetos, entre os quais, os índices. 
Qual a função deles? 
 
Resposta 
Selecionada: 
b. 
Colocar um marcador no dado para permitir uma 
recuperação da mesma de forma mais rápida. 
Respostas: a. 
É um tipo especial de dado. 
 
b. 
Colocar um marcador no dado para permitir uma 
recuperação da mesma de forma mais rápida. 
 c. 
Armazenar dados em forma de colunas e linhas. 
 d. 
Todas as afirmativas anteriores estão corretas. 
 e. 
NDA.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: B 
Comentário: os índices são objetos do banco de dados 
que servem para otimizar consultas. 
 
 
 Pergunta 7 
0,25 em 0,25 pontos 
 
Uma das principais diferenças entre os bancos Oracle e o SQL Server 
diz respeito a: 
 
Resposta Selecionada: a. 
Tratamento de campos tipo data. 
Respostas: a. 
Tratamento de campos tipo data. 
 b. 
Na linguagem SQL. 
 c. 
Nos grupos básicos de tipos de dados. 
 d. 
Não tem diferenças. 
 e. 
NDA.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: A 
Comentário: a forma de tratamento de datas no Oracle e 
no SQL Server é bem diferente. 
 
 
 Pergunta 8 
0,25 em 0,25 pontos 
 
Foi solicitado ao DBA que desse permissão de uma tabela a um 
usuário X. Para dar a permissão, é correto informar que o DBA usou 
que tipo de linguagem? 
 
Resposta Selecionada: d. 
DCL. 
Respostas: a. 
DTL. 
 b. 
DQL. 
 c. 
DML. 
 d. 
DCL. 
 e. 
NDA.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: D 
Comentário: DCL, ou Data Control Language, ou 
linguagem de controle de dados, é o tipo de linguagem 
SQL que controla a parte de permissões. 
 
 
 Pergunta 9 
0,25 em 0,25 pontos 
 
Foi pedido a um desenvolvedor que desenvolvesse 
uma procedure para resolver um determinado problema no banco de 
dados. Para tanto, o desenvolvedor usou o tipo de linguagem chamado: 
 
Resposta Selecionada: a. 
DTL. 
 
Respostas: a. 
DTL. 
 b. 
DQL. 
 c. 
DML. 
 d. 
DCL. 
 e. 
NDA.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: A 
Comentário: para o desenvolvimento de procedures, ou 
seja, programas dentro do banco de dados, utilizamos a 
DTL. 
 
 Pergunta 10 
0,25 em 0,25 pontos 
 
Comandos como SELECT, FROM, WHERE, INNER JOIN fazem parte 
de que grupo da linguagem SQL? 
 
Resposta Selecionada: b. 
DQL. 
Respostas: a. 
DTL. 
 b. 
DQL. 
 c. 
DML. 
 d. 
DCL. 
 e. 
NDA. 
Feedback da 
resposta: 
Resposta Correta: Alternativa: B 
Comentário: o DQL é responsável pela linguagem de 
consulta ao banco de dados e todos os comandos que 
fazem parte dela.

Continue navegando